Configuring Eudora light with shell access.


Follow this steps after you have installed Eudora Light .

Now, clicking on the Eudora icon will start this program. However, you have to configure Eudora for your SHELL account before you can use it.
After you start the program the first thing Eudora does is pop up a window called `Setting'. (Afterwards, click on the `Tools' - `Options' menu.) On left hand side there will be some icons.

Each of these icons is to be clicked and relative settings on right hand side are to be made.

Please note that the following information is specific to a VSNL Mumbai account. In other cities you will have to use appropriate IP addresses or your POP and SMTP servers.
Set up your configuration as follows.

  4. Checking mail
    POP account: username@giasbma.vsnl.net.in
    Check for mail every "10" minutes: In this instance Eudora will check whether you have received any new email every 10 minutes while you are connected. Our suggestion is that you leave this "0" so that you can initiate the checking of mail by going to File menu and clicking on Check mail.
    Select: "Send on check"
    Check the box for save password, which will save your password and you won't have to key it again and again every time you check your mail.
    If you check the next item, "Leave the mail on the server", then even after downloading the mail the mail will be left in your account at VSNL. Again our suggestion is to leave this box unchecked so your mail box at VSNL remains uncluttered.
    Select Authentication Style as "Passwords".
  5. Sending mail
    Return address is to be put as "username@giasbma.vsnl.net.in".
    SMTP server is to be put as "giasbma.vsnl.net.in".
    The next box labeled "Immediate Send" should be unchecked. This will permit you to compose and queue the mail you are sending off line. Then when you connect up, you can go to File menu and click on "Send Queued Messages". Otherwise if you keep this item checked. When you compose off line each time you finish the message and press "Send" button, it will automatically log on and send the mail.
